King Mohammed VI to Chair Ministerial Council Discussing 2026 Finance Law
In the coming days, His Majesty King Mohammed VI is expected to chair a ministerial council to discuss several strategic issues, primarily the general guidelines for the draft finance law for 2026, as well as approving military-related draft decrees, international agreements, and high-level appointments.
The new finance law is anticipated to reflect the directives from the King’s recent address before Parliament at the opening of the legislative session, where he called for a transformative shift in the education and health sectors as essential pillars of the social state. This aligns with efforts to enhance the economic integration of youth, create job opportunities, and reduce social and regional inequalities, which remain major developmental challenges in Morocco.
Priority funding and practical measures are expected to be allocated to the education and health sectors, in line with the expansion of social protection and the activation of commitments under the new development model, which positions social and regional justice as a fundamental lever for achieving comprehensive development.
